Australia boosts Sri Lankan aid by $10m

Australia will provide a further $10 million in humanitarian assistance to civilians affected by the conflict in northern Sri Lanka.

Foreign Minister Stephen Smith said on Friday the money would be distributed through United Nations agencies.

Mr Smith said the money would be used to provide water, sanitation, shelter, food and health care.
